Seas are given as significant wave height, which is the average
height of the highest 1/3 of the waves. Individual waves may be
more than twice the significant wave height.

Wave Detail will include details about the period and direction
of origin for the highest energy waves. Long-period swells coming
from a different direction than the wind would be included in the
Wave Detail.

Synopsis for Keys coastal waters from Ocean Reef to Dry Tortugas
1021 PM EDT Sun Sep 22 2024

.SYNOPSIS...Light to gentle easterly flow across the Keys coastal
waters overnight will continue to increase Monday through
Tuesday, as high pressure builds along the Eastern Seaboard, and a
tropical low slowly develops in the northwestern Caribbean Sea.
Heading through the middle and later part of the week, the
forecast will depend on the potential development and movement of
this low. At this time, we expect fresh to strong east to
southeast breezes to develop late Tuesday, becoming southerly late
in the week, with the strongest winds over western sections of
the Keys waters. Mariners should continue to closely monitor the
latest forecast updates during the next several days.
